- N +

智能软件工具助力企业实现云端协作与自动化流程优化管理方案

智能软件工具助力企业实现云端协作与自动化流程优化管理方案原标题:智能软件工具助力企业实现云端协作与自动化流程优化管理方案

导读:

以下是根据您的要求撰写的技术文档示例:CodeMaster IDE技术文档1. 核心功能概述CodeMaster IDE是一款面向全栈开发者的集成开发环境,支持Java、Pyt...

以下是根据您的要求撰写的技术文档示例:

CodeMaster IDE技术文档

1. 核心功能概述

智能软件工具助力企业实现云端协作与自动化流程优化管理方案

CodeMaster IDE是一款面向全栈开发者的集成开发环境,支持Java、Python、JavaScript等20+编程语言。该工具通过智能代码补全、实时调试和云端协同三大核心模块,将开发效率提升40%以上。其独有的AI辅助编程引擎可自动识别代码模式,为复杂算法提供优化建议。

在Web开发场景中,CodeMaster IDE内置的REST API测试工具可直接在编辑器内模拟请求响应,配合可视化数据库浏览器,开发者无需切换工具即可完成全链路调试。针对微服务架构,工具提供容器化部署向导,支持一键生成Dockerfile与Kubernetes配置模板。

2. 安装与启动

2.1 系统要求

  • 操作系统:Windows 10 64位(1809以上)/ macOS 10.15+/ Ubuntu 20.04 LTS
  • 处理器:Intel i5 8代或同级AMD处理器(推荐配备AVX2指令集)
  • 内存:8GB最小(16GB推荐)
  • 存储:SSD硬盘需预留15GB空间
  • 图形:支持OpenGL 4.5的独立显卡
  • 2.2 安装流程

    1. 访问CodeMaster官网下载对应平台安装包

    2. 执行安装向导(Windows需以管理员身份运行)

    3. 完成许可证激活(支持离线激活文件或在线账户绑定)

    4. 首次启动时选择工作区路径和主题配置

    安装完成后,用户可在终端执行`codemaster version`验证版本信息。若遇到驱动兼容性问题,建议更新显卡驱动至最新版本。

    3. 环境配置指南

    3.1 语言SDK管理

    CodeMaster IDE集成SDK管理器,支持多版本运行时环境共存:

    bash

    添加Python 3.11开发环境

    codemaster sdk install

    切换默认JDK版本

    codemaster sdk default java@17

    环境变量自动注入机制确保不同项目使用指定SDK版本,配置文件存储在`~/.codemaster/env`目录下。

    3.2 插件扩展

    通过内置插件市场可安装200+扩展组件:

    1. 按Ctrl+Shift+P打开命令面板

    2. 输入"Install Extension

    3. 搜索所需插件(如GitLens、Jupyter Notebook)

    4. 点击安装并重启IDE

    开发团队可配置私有插件仓库,在`settings.json`中添加:

    json

    extensions.gallery": {

    privateRegistry": "

    4. 项目调试技巧

    4.1 断点配置

    在代码行号左侧单击设置断点,右键可配置条件断点:

  • 命中次数:当断点触发N次后暂停
  • 日志表达式:不中断程序但记录变量值
  • 依赖断点:仅在另一个断点触发后生效
  • 使用内存分析器时,CodeMaster IDE会标记潜在的内存泄漏点。在JavaScript调试中,工具支持ES6+语法源码映射,可直接调试TypeScript原始代码。

    4.2 性能优化

    启用CPU Profiler后,开发者可捕获方法级执行耗时:

    1. 打开性能分析面板

    2. 开始记录并执行测试用例

    3. 分析火焰图定位瓶颈方法

    4. 使用AI优化建议重构代码

    对于Web项目,内置的Lighthouse集成可生成性能评分报告,自动建议资源压缩、缓存策略等优化方案。

    5. 云端协同开发

    CodeMaster IDE的Live Share功能支持实时协作:

  • 共享完整开发环境(包括终端和调试器)
  • 语音通话集成(基于WebRTC技术)
  • 细粒度权限控制(可限制文件编辑范围)
  • 团队项目建议配置SSO单点登录,在管理控制台设置OAuth 2.0提供商信息。代码片段共享支持加密链接,设置有效期和访问密码确保信息安全。

    6. 安全配置建议

    1. 启用自动更新通道:

    json

    update.channel": "stable",

    autoUpdate": true

    2. 配置代码扫描规则:

  • 开启CVE漏洞数据库实时监控
  • 自定义正则表达式检测敏感信息
  • 设置提交前强制安全扫描
  • 3. 审计日志管理:

  • 操作日志自动上传至SIEM系统
  • 异常登录触发二次验证
  • 保留180天历史版本快照
  • 7. 故障排查方法

    7.1 常见问题处理

  • 插件冲突:进入安全模式(codemaster safe-mode)逐个排查
  • 内存溢出:调整JVM参数`-Xmx4096m`
  • 渲染异常:关闭硬件加速`"disable-hardware-acceleration": true`
  • 7.2 日志收集

    调试日志分为三个级别:

    bash

    获取详细运行日志

    codemaster log-level=verbose > debug.log

    查看渲染进程日志

    tail -f ~/.codemaster/logs/renderer.log

    技术团队可通过诊断工具生成系统报告:

    1. 帮助菜单选择"Collect Diagnostic Data

    2. 自动生成包含系统配置、错误日志的ZIP包

    3. 上传至支持中心进行分析

    本文共提及"CodeMaster IDE"工具12次,涵盖安装部署、日常使用、系统维护全生命周期管理要点,满足开发团队从入门到进阶的技术需求。实际使用中建议配合官方文档中心的最新版本说明进行操作。

    返回列表
    上一篇:
    下一篇: